@charset "utf-8";
/* CSS Document */
#wrap{width:100%;height:100%;position:relative;text-align:left;zoom:1;}
.sitemap_bg {;background:url('../img/common/sitemap_bg.jpg') no-repeat;}
.company_bg {;background:url('../img/common/cont_bg.jpg') no-repeat;}
.biz_bg {background:url('../img/common/biz_bg.jpg') no-repeat;}
.recruit_bg {background:url('../img/common/recruit_bg.jpg') no-repeat;}
.pr_bg {background:url('../img/common/pr_bg.jpg') no-repeat;}
.cs_bg {background:url('../img/common/cs_bg.jpg') no-repeat;}
.main_bg {background:url('../img/common/main_bg.jpg') no-repeat;}

#head_wrap{width:100%;position:relative;height:20px;}
#head_wrap .menu {float:right;height:22px;font-size:11px;color:#717171;padding-right:100px;display:none;}
#head_wrap .menu ul {margin-top:17px;}
#head_wrap .menu li {float:left;_height:15px;}

#body_wrap{width:100%;position:relative;}
#contents_wrap { word-wrap:break; word-break:break-all; line-height: 140%;}

#top_wrap { margin-top:17px;}
#top_wrap h2 { float:left;width:216px;margin-left:30px; }
#top_wrap .banner { float:left; }

#logo_area {float: left;width:59px; height:27px; vertical-align:bottom;margin-left:30px;}
#logo_area h1 {vertical-align:bottom;}

#sub_wrap {width:960px;float:left;min-height:200px;margin-top:200px;}

#sub_cont_wrap {width:637px;min-height:200px;float:left;margin:58px 0 0 30px;}

#right_wrap {overflow:hidden;width:200px;height:300px;float:right;}
#left_wrap {width:162px;float:left;margin-right:10px;margin-left:42px;_margin-left:22px;}
.left_company {background:url('../img/common/left_bg.gif') no-repeat;min-height:400px;_height:400px;}
.left_sitemap {background:url('../img/common/left_sitemap.gif') no-repeat;min-height:400px;_height:400px;}
.left_biz {background:url('../img/common/left_bottom_biz.gif') no-repeat;min-height:400px;_height:400px;_height:400px;}
.left_recruit {background:url('../img/common/left_bottom_recruit.gif') no-repeat;min-height:400px;_height:400px;}
.left_pr {background:url('../img/common/left_bottom_pr.gif') no-repeat;min-height:400px;_height:400px;}
.left_cs {background:url('../img/common/left_bottom_cs.gif') no-repeat;min-height:400px;_height:400px;}

#left_wrap .sub_title {width:162px;clear:both;}
#left_wrap ul.sub {margin:5px 0 5px 0;}

.layout_fixed {width:1004px;position:relative;}

.menu_bg {width:657px;height:28px;background:url('../img/common/menu_bg.gif');float:left;margin-left:50px;margin-top:5px;}
.menu_bg li {position:relative;cursor:pointer;float:left;margin-right:25px;}
.menu_bg ul {float:left;margin:0 auto;margin-left:50px;_margin-left:10px;}
.menu_bg ul li ul {position:absolute;width:400px;*top:28px;*left:-10px;margin-left:0px;}
.menu_bg ul li ul li {float:left;margin-right:0px;}
.menu_bg .default {display:none;}
.menu_bg .over {display:block;}

.cont_area {width:100%;float:left;}

#foot_wrap ui li {float:left;background:#ffffff;}
#foot_wrap {clear:both;height:30px;font-size:11px;color:#7D7C7C;line-height:140%;color:#8c8c8c;background:#ffffff;}
#foot_wrap .copy {width:100%;clear:both;color:#858586;font-family:verdana;font-size:10px;margin-bottom:20px;padding-top:10px;}

.paging_area {width:100%;padding:10px 0 10px 0;line-height:30px;font-family:verdana;font-family:dotum;font-size:11px;text-align:center;clear:both;color:#aaaaaa;}
.paging_area strong {color:#000;font-size:12px;}
.paging_area a {padding:7px 10px 5px 10px; background:#fff;margin-right:3px;font-weight:bold;}
.paging_area a.on {padding:7px 10px 5px 10px; background:#fff;color:#168800;margin-right:3px;font-weight:bold;}
.paging_area a.none {padding:5px 10px 5px 10px;margin-right:3px;font-size:12px;border:1px solid #fff;}

.btn_area {width:100%;text-align:right;margin-top:18px;float:left;}
.btn_area .left {float:left;}
.btn_area .right {float:right;}

.btn_center_area {width:100%;text-align:center;}


span.f14_b {font-size:14px; font-weight:bold;}
span.f11 {font-size:11px;color:#878787;}
span.gray {color:#777777;}

.select1 {width:150px;height:20px;font-size:11px;border:1px solid #b3b2af;}
.input1 {width:150px;height:15px;font-size:11px;border:1px solid #b3b2af;}
.input2 {width:30px;height:15px;font-size:11px;border:1px solid #b3b2af;}
.input3 {width:80px;height:15px;font-size:11px;border:1px solid #b3b2af;}

.textarea1 {width:500px;height:50px;border:1px solid #b3b2af;margin:5px 0 5px 0;}

span.txt_name {color:#777;font-size:11px;}
span.txt_price {color:#e05d01;font-size:11px;font-weight:bold;}


.button1 {width:39px;height:18px;line-height:18px;font-size:11px;letter-spacing:-1px;text-align:center;font-weight:bold;color:#fff;float:left;border:1px solid #8d8d8d;background:url(../img/common/button1_bg.gif) repeat-x;}
.button2 {width:39px;height:18px;line-height:18px;font-size:11px;letter-spacing:-1px;text-align:center;font-weight:bold;color:#777;float:left;border:1px solid #8d8d8d;background:url(../img/common/button2_bg.gif) repeat-x;}

.align_le {float:left;}
.align_ri {float:right;}

.list_01 {width:100%;}
.list_01 th {background:url('../img/admin/th_bg.gif') repeat-x 10px 0;height:22px;}
.list_01 th.left {background:url('../img/admin/th_left.gif') no-repeat left;}
.list_01 th.right {background:url('../img/admin/th_right.gif') no-repeat right;}
.list_01 td {height:25px;text-align:center;border-bottom:1px solid #ccc;}
.list_01 td.left {text-align:left;padding-left:15px;}

.view_01 {width:100%;padding-top:6px;}
.view_01 th {background:#f2f2f2;height:22px;border-bottom:1px solid #ccc;text-align:center;}
.view_01 th.bg {background:url('../img/admin/th_bg_top.gif') repeat-x;_background:url('../img/admin/th_bg_top.gif') repeat-x 0 6px;*background:url('../img/admin/th_bg_top.gif') repeat-x 0 6px;height:22px;border-bottom:1px solid #ccc;}
.view_01 td {height:25px;text-align:left;padding-left:15px;border-bottom:1px solid #ccc;}
.view_01 td.cont {padding:20px;text-align:left;line-height:160%;color:#666666;}
.view_01 td.write {padding:5px;text-align:left;color:#666666;}

.article {width:100%;border-top:1px solid #a0a0a0;}
.article th {color:#646464;background:#f2f2f2;height:22px;border-bottom:1px dotted #d1d1d1;}
.article td {height:25px;text-align:left;padding-left:15px;border-bottom:1px dotted #d1d1d1;}
.article .line {border-bottom:1px solid #f26680;}


.main_banner {width:336px;height:260px;float:left;position:relative;margin:40px 0 0 20px;}
.main_banner .tab {position:absolute;top:25px;left:15px;}
.main_banner p {position:absolute;}
.main_banner li {cursor:pointer;}
.main_banner .show {display:block;}
.main_banner .hide {display:none;}

.main_banner2 {width:295px;float:left;margin:40px 0 0 20px;}

.main_notice {width:200px;float:left;margin:40px 0 0 20px;}
.main_notice ul {margin:5px 0 20px 0;}
.main_notice li {line-height:20px;padding-left:13px;background:url('../img/common/main_notice_arrow.gif') no-repeat 3px 7px;}
.main_notice li a {color:#666;font-size:11px;text-decoration:none;}


.sitemap_01 {width:200px;height:300px;background:url('../img/page/sitemap_bg_01.gif') no-repeat;padding:26px 0 0 15px;margin-left:-20px;}
.sitemap_02 {width:200px;height:300px;background:url('../img/page/sitemap_bg_02.gif') no-repeat;padding:26px 0 0 15px;margin-left:-20px;}
.sitemap_03 {width:200px;height:300px;background:url('../img/page/sitemap_bg_03.gif') no-repeat;padding:26px 0 0 15px;margin-left:-20px;}
.sitemap_04 {width:200px;height:150px;background:url('../img/page/sitemap_bg_04.gif') no-repeat;padding:26px 0 0 15px;margin-left:-20px;}
.sitemap_05 {width:200px;height:150px;background:url('../img/page/sitemap_bg_05.gif') no-repeat;padding:26px 0 0 15px;margin-left:-20px;}

.sitemap {float:left;}
.sitemap ul {margin:0;}
.sitemap ul li {background:url('../img/page/sitemap_arrow_01.gif') no-repeat 1px 4px;padding-left:20px;line-height:25px;font-weight:bold;}
.sitemap ul li a {text-decoration:none;}
.sitemap ul li ul {clear:both;margin-left:-10px;}
.sitemap ul li ul li {background:url('../img/page/sitemap_arrow_02.gif') no-repeat 10px 6px;line-height:16px;padding-left:-10px;font-size:11px;font-weight:normal;}
.sitemap ul li ul li a {color:#888888;text-decoration:none;}